The SDBJ is a part of my Making The Connection networking workshop. I bring in an issue and we discuss how they can use it to:
- Be conversant in current events – Make networking conversations easier
- Find information to share with those in your network
- Learn about the “Movers & Shakers” in your community…imagine running into someone at the next event and being able to comment of their recent article…believe me…they will be impressed and flattered
- Find events/seminars for yourself and others
- Learn of future “Awards” events and nominate someone
- Learn of future articles in their editorial Calendar
- Learn the top companies in major industries And more!
For the proactive, creative thinker there are several pieces of useful information in every issue. Did someone you know get a promotion? Send a congratulations card! Did you notice a business meeting that will pull in a certain audience demographic? Share that information with others! When it comes to speakers, the more influential the speaker, the more influential the audience.
In my PowerPartner Appoach® Trainings, we define networking as “The exchange of Ideas, Information & Resources”. Keeping current with your community’s business news to find information to share with your network is imperative to staying ahead of your competition.
